Performance and Compatibility Considerations While the technology is advanced, performance is not always identical to using a physical device. Resource-intensive games or applications may stutter or fail to run optimally depending on the host PC's hardware. Integrated graphics often struggle with the rendering demands of modern Android titles. Therefore, it is advisable to test less demanding applications first to gauge the thermal and graphical stability of your specific setup. The compatibility list fluctuates constantly. Developers are gradually optimizing their apps for the WSA environment, but some may still rely on libraries or hardware access that are not fully supported. Users might encounter apps that install but refuse to open, or those that function but lack critical features like push notifications. Checking community forums for specific app issues is a recommended troubleshooting step.
